POSITION SUMMARY:

The Clinical Laboratory Scientist analyzes specimens and maintains equipment in good operating condition.

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• 1-2 years of experience as a Medical Technologist or equivalent in a clinical laboratory environment.
  • BS/BA degree (or equivalent) in Medical Technology, Biological Sciences, or related field
  • Current California CLS license (Clinical Laboratory Science - Generalist) or CGMBS license (Clinical Genetics Molecular Biology Scientist)

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ES:

  • Excellent interpersonal, communication, computer, troubleshooting, and pipetting skills.
  • Experience in Molecular Biology.
  • Excellent oral and written communication skills.
  • Word processing and data management skills.

Responsibilities
  • Verify the proper specimen being analyzed and perform tests that need to be completed
  • Analyze clinical laboratory specimens following the standard methods and procedures in an efficient manner with little to no errors
  • Responsible for maintaining updated understanding and knowledge of methods performed in the lab
  • Follows GLP (good laboratory practice): maintain clean and organized work space
  • Completes training and other deadlines on time.
  • Go-to person when lead/supervisor is not available
  • Train on specialized instructions for instruments/protocols (super users)
  • Recognizes and escalates equipment malfunctions; troubleshoots common errors
  • Recognizes, documents, and escalates protocol deviations in lab to lead/supervisor
  • Participates in the updating of departmental standard operating procedures and database to accurately reflect the current practices.
  • Ensures compliance with all regulatory agency requirements through proper documentation

• Performs quality control procedures to ensure accuracy of clinical data (if applicable) • Maintains equipment and instruments in good operating condition

  • Communicates with team and other departments (including via e-mail)
  • Provides feedback on day-to-day schedule and tasks to lead/supervisor; offers suggestions/ideas for improvement
  • Assists teammates in completing daily tasks
  • Conducts himself/herself in a professional manner; acts as a role model/mentor to others
  • Adheres to Departmental Expectations
  • This role works with PHI on a regular basis both in paper and electronic form and have an access to various technologies to access PHI (paper and electronic) in order to perform the job
  • Employee must complete training relating to HIPAA/PHI privacy, General Policies and Procedure Compliance training and security training as soon as possible but not later than the first 30 days of hire.
